Dreams Palacio de Hielo

Dreams Palacio de Hielo (Calle Silvano 77, Madrid): este centro comercial ofrece compras, ocio y deportes con una de las increíbles pistas de patinaje sobre hielo de toda Europa. Esta pista es de 1800 metros cuadrados. Además, cuenta con salas de cine, restaurantes, piscina cubierta, gimnasio, solárium y una bolera.

Centro Comercial Málaga Plaza

Centro Comercial Málaga Plaza (Calle Armengual de la Mota 12, Málaga) – with over 50 (mostly Spanish) retailers on site, this is one of the Málaga’s more popular shopping malls. The French-based electronics and music chain FNAC has a large presence there.
